NI announces CompactRIO performance controller
NI announces CompactRIO performance controller
The CompactRIO performance controller integrates an Intel Atom processor and Xilinx Kintex-7 FPGA technology for improved performance and easier system integration.

August 6, 2014 – NI announced the CompactRIO performance controller which integrates embedded technologies from Intel and Xilinx and is fully supported by LabVIEW 2014 and NI Linux Real-Time. It is ideal for advanced control and applications in harsh, industrial environments and provides high-performance processing, custom timing and triggering, and data transfer from modular C Series I/O. LabVIEW 2014 with NI Linux Real-Time support lets engineers and scientists use a single, familiar development environment to continue developing their system while taking immediate advantage of increased CompactRIO hardware performance.

Key Features

  • Intel Atom Processor: Close the loop faster, tackle more tasks with the same controller, and process data with more precision, accuracy and speed with this dual-core processor.
  • Kintex-7 FPGA: Process more channels and implement more complex filtering and control algorithms.
  • NI Linux Real-Time: Get access to an extensive community of applications and IP with a robust Linux -based real-time OS.
  • Embedded UI: Implement a local HMI device and use the control system to handle HMI tasks, cutting component costs as well as development and integration time.
  • Improved Vision Integration: Add USB3 or GigE Vision cameras using NI Linux Real-Time, integrate vision acquisition directly into an application, and use new Vision IP to turn the FPGA into a high-performance vision coprocessor.
